The shim for the locking nut is a stroke of genius. I ended up putting a Kahler string lock that goes behind the original nut on my project, but your solution is absolutely perfect! I’m interested to hear how you find the bridge dives with it decked flat on the body top. That’s how I wanted to set line up, but I found that deep dives were restricted as the leading front edge of the baseplate wanted to pivot into the top of the body. The only two solutions I could see was a) route a small channel between the mounting studs so the bridge could pivot into it, or b) raise the bridge so it was floating. I went with option 2, which is cool but I really liked the idea of the baseplate making full connection with the body for maximum tone.
